Assistant Restaurant Manager Salary in Baytown, TX

Assistant Restaurant Managers in Baytown, TX, in 2025, earn approximately $23.00 per hour, which translates to about $920.00 per week, $3,986.67 per month, and $47,840.00 per year.

The demand for Assistant Restaurant Managers in Baytown is growing steadily at about 5% per year, indicating a positive outlook and expanding opportunities in the hospitality sector.

How Much Does an Assistant Restaurant Manager Make in Baytown, TX?

The salary of an Assistant Restaurant Manager in Baytown can vary based on experience, responsibilities, and establishment type. Here’s a breakdown of earnings across experience levels:

Experience levelHourly payWeekly payMonthly payYearly pay
Entry-level (~25th percentile)$20.00$800.00$3,466.67$41,600.00
Mid-level (average)$23.00$920.00$3,953.33$47,840.00
Top earners (90th percentile)$28.00$1,120.00$4,853.33$58,240.00

Do Assistant Restaurant Managers in Baytown Earn Tips?

Assistant Restaurant Managers generally do not earn tips, as their role is more focused on management and operational duties rather than direct customer service. Their compensation is primarily based on salary or hourly wages.

What Influences an Assistant Restaurant Manager’s Salary in Baytown?

Several key factors impact how much an Assistant Restaurant Manager can earn:

  • Experience and Tenure: Those with more years managing teams and operations often command higher pay.
  • Skill Set and Training: Strong leadership, people management, and problem-solving skills increase value to employers.
  • Type of Restaurant: Upscale, fine dining, or high-volume establishments usually offer better compensation than casual or fast food venues.
  • Certification and Education: Holding certifications such as ServSafe Manager or specialized hospitality management training can boost earnings.
  • Local Market Conditions: Demand for hospitality staff and local economic conditions also affect salaries.

How To Become an Assistant Restaurant Manager in Baytown

Becoming an Assistant Restaurant Manager involves a combination of education, experience, and certifications:

  • Culinary Arts Program at Lee College: Provides comprehensive training to develop restaurant management capabilities.
  • Hospitality Management Program at San Jacinto College: Focuses on operational management skills vital for restaurant supervisors.
  • ServSafe Manager Certification: A nationally recognized credential ensuring food safety compliance.
  • Texas Alcoholic Beverage Commission (TABC) Certification: Mandatory for managers in Texas establishments serving alcohol, confirming legal knowledge.
  • Gain Experience: Starting in entry-level roles like server or shift supervisor helps build relevant skills and knowledge.

Establishments That Assistant Restaurant Managers in Baytown Work At

Assistant Restaurant Managers typically find employment across a variety of establishment types:

  • Fast Food Restaurants: These offer steady hours and experience managing high-volume quick service.
  • Casual and Family Dining: Often providing opportunities to develop hands-on operational leadership skills.
  • Fine Dining and Upscale Restaurants: Positions may offer higher salaries but require advanced management skills and experience.
  • Catering and Banquet Halls: These venues additionally provide variety in management challenges and customer service exposure.

The type of establishment significantly influences salary, with upscale and high volume venues typically paying more.
